In addition to the "Linux Audio Mini Summit" that Takashi announced
recently (which focuses more on ALSA topics), we will also have a
"PulseAudio miniconference" in the same conference center, day after the
ALSA event. The PulseAudio event will be on Wednesday, starting at
14:00. Registering isn't mandatory, but if we run out of seats, those
who were fastest to register will get preference.

I think we should revive the "dynamic PCM for HDMI" stuff, that reprobes the devices when they are plugged in (or something like that).

When we talked about this two years ago my idea was to make pa_card instances that would appear and disappear as HDMI was plugged/unplugged, but since, profiles have gained availability. I haven't looked more closely at it, but maybe we could keep the pa_card as it is and instead change the availability of the profiles as the HDMI devices are plugged in and unplugged.
